Dude. It DID help. It clearly states to call up the applicable roadside service and get them to get it out.
If you are a member it's free. If not you would have to join up - not a waste as it gets you a years membership too.
Also it's accessible pretty much 24/7 where locksmiths work generally normal hours.

Whenever I am working in the boot of my Euro I make sure to open one of the passenger doors so that the whole car stays unlocked to avoid situations like this. It's easy enough to do.

Get in the front seat of the car, lock the doors using the remote. Then unlock the doors using the remote and wait. It should still lock itself back up eventhough you are in the front seat.
This is the same with most cars, even my old Datsun 120Y from years and years ago. You can't lock the driver's door by hand and then slam it close. It will unlock itself automatically. To get around it, you pull the door handle on the outside while closing the door. This will allow it to stay locked.
